Understanding Car Locksmith Services
Car locksmiths specialize in the design, production, and maintenance of security systems for lorries. Traditionally, their work focused mainly on mechanical keys and locks, but with the arrival of innovative electronic systems, their function has broadened considerably. Today's car locksmith professionals require to be skilled in various innovations to efficiently service a broad array of vehicle makes and designs.
Common Services Offered by Car Locksmiths
Key Replacement and Duplication: One of the most common jobs, this service includes producing new keys, whether they are lost by the owner or extra copies are required.
Transponder Key Programming: Modern vehicles typically utilize transponder keys that need specific programming. Locksmiths have the essential equipment to program these keys so that they communicate correctly with the vehicle.
Ignition Repair and Replacement: When a vehicle's ignition system breakdowns, locksmiths can diagnose and repair the issue, making sure that the vehicle starts efficiently.
Emergency Lockout Services: Car locksmiths are often the very first call when somebody is locked out of their vehicle, able to quickly and efficiently bring back gain access to without damage.
Smart Key Services: With the frequency of keyless entry and push-start systems, car locksmiths likewise deal with clever keys and fobs to program or replace them as required.
Types of Car Keys
With the automotive market's shift toward digital and electronic solutions, the types of car type in use have actually diversified, each bringing distinct advantages and security functions.
1. Conventional Mechanical Keys
These are one of the most standard type of car keys, still utilized in older automobiles. They are basic metal keys that suit a lock and turn to unlock. While lots of modern lorries no longer utilize them, they are understood for their reliability and ease of duplication.
2. Transponder Keys
Introduced in the 1990s, transponder keys added an integrated chip that interacts with the vehicle's ignition system. If the wrong key is used, the vehicle will not start. This innovation substantially increased vehicle security.
3. Remote Key Fobs
Remote key fobs allow motorists to lock and open their lorries from a distance. Though they started as a separate device, numerous newer car keys include remote functionality, which makes gain access to more hassle-free.
4. Smart Keys
As the most innovative choice, smart keys use RFID (Radio Frequency Identification) technology. They allow keyless entry and push-button start features, enhancing both security and convenience.

Frequently Asked Questions on Car Locksmith Keys
Q1: How much does it cost to replace a car key with a locksmith?
Costs can vary extensively depending upon the key type and the vehicle design. Normally, conventional keys are cheaper to replace, while transponder keys and wise keys can be more pricey, sometimes reaching a number of hundred dollars.
Q2: Can a locksmith make a key without the original?
Yes, expert locksmiths have tools and processes to recreate a key without requiring the original. This typically includes deciphering the lock cylinder or accessing vehicle key codes.
Q3: How can I avoid my car key from being stolen?
Be conscious of your key's place, avoid leaving it in obvious places, and utilize innovation like smart device apps to track your keys. Some advanced keys also provide functions to disable the vehicle from another location if theft is believed.
Q4: Are all car locksmiths qualified to program my vehicle's key?
Not all locksmith professionals are equipped to deal with innovative key systems. It's important to guarantee your chosen locksmith has the required credentials and equipment.
